Is this even a real business? I was looking to get a new car stereo installed, and this place is in my neighborhood so I came here first. Nobody was there! I came during their listed business hours. One thing that really threw me off is that there are 3 other businesses with the same name all next to each other (the audio place across the street from the other 2). There are also at least 3 phone numbers listed online and on the storess doors. Nobody answered any of them, but the voicemail greeting is this confusing rap that starts out like a middle-schoolers.
Went with a friend